Contracts Manager Supply Chain (H/F) – SAFRAN SEATS USA LLC Safran Seats is a leading global manufacturer of aircraft seats for crew and passengers. Safran is a high-technology international group operating in the aerospace, space and defense sectors, employing around 100,000 people with revenue of 27.3 billion euros in 2024. Safran Seats produces an all-inclusive range of passenger seats for commercial aircraft, from economy to first class. Mission description: As a member of the Safran Seats business, you contribute to teamwork that delivers over one million seats to major airlines worldwide. You will support quality, innovation and customer-focused solutions, collaborating with Sales & Marketing, Customer Service, Program Management, Engineering, Supply Chain, and Procurement. Depending on assignment, you may focus on Customer Contracts or Supply Chain Contracts. Position Objective

Objective: Apply procedures and techniques to effectively review, draft, amend, negotiate, and securely store contracts. Assist in creating and maintaining an effective Contracts Management function compliant with applicable statutory and regulatory requirements. Lead or assist with contract negotiations on a case-by-case basis and provide contractual expertise across global teams. Main Function Responsibilities

Perform risk assessment of contract terms and conditions; develop strategies to minimize potential risks to the business. Work with management, internal stakeholders, customers, suppliers, and other third parties to resolve issues to ensure successful contract execution. Ensure adherence to contract policies, processes, and guidelines; maintain secure contract documentation in the Safran Seats Contracts Database and, as required, paper files. Advise management of contractual rights and obligations; compile and analyze data; maintain historical information. Perform other duties as assigned. Qualification Requirements

Education & Qualification: Bachelor’s degree required; law degree and license to practice law in at least one state preferred. Work Experience: 4+ years of experience in commercial contracts; technical knowledge as applicable. Professional Skills: Proficiency in MS Word; ability to generate written communication; strong contract analysis, drafting, and negotiation skills; clear and effective written and verbal English communication. Behavioral Skills: Ability to work independently, strong oral and written communication, integrity, tenacity, teamwork, stress tolerance, and ability to perform under time pressure or ambiguity. Desirable Aspects: Aerospace sector experience; supply chain manufacturing contract experience; manufacturing environment experience; experience with legal/contractual software and tools. Travel: International and/or domestic travel required; less than 10%. Seniorities and Employment
